[QUOTE="TripleE44, post: 1459184, member: 94"] I had dusting with Chemical Guys V line of polishes. I've since moved on from them to Shine Supply mainly. I've grown to hate Chemical guys also. 20 different types of everything, all advertised to have their own specific uses. Overhyped and all that. I bought into it at one point, obviously. I've moved onto Shine Supply and CarPro just like Blake said earlier in the thread. Shine Supply polishes and compounds seem to be a lot more efficient, and even the heavier ones finish down incredibly well. The rest of their stuff is good too, but the tire cleaner and polishes are really my favorites. I've used the megs polishes, but I never really seemed to get great results from them. Not really sure why, seems like I hear a lot of people loving them. [/QUOTE]
